Turning the compass bar on and off
You turn the compass bar on and off from the data toolbar.
• Press the DATA button.
Use the DATABAR softkey to turn the compass bar on or off.
Note:
When the compass bar is displayed the transducer icons remain visible in the top-right
section of the screen.
Compass bar setup
The compass bar is set to open in heading mode. To change this setting, press the
MENU button and go to the Databar Setup menu where you can select either Heading
or COG.
Note:
If MOB is activated while the compass bar is open, the compass is replaced with the
MOB toolbar. The compass bar returns when you cancel the active MOB.
Table 18-1: DATABAR Softkey Options
ON Displays the standard databar, at the top or side of the
screen depending on your setup options.
COMPASS Replaces the standard databar with the compass bar,
displayed along the top of the screen.
OFF Removes both the databar and the compass bar from your
display.
